Impact evaluation is such a critical piece to what we do as an organization.
It proves that what we are doing is actually achieving the intended impact on the beneficiaries who we serve. It also allows us to benchmark year over year our success to determine if we are successfully building on our impact year over year.
Teams should be quite familiar with impact evaluation – after all, it is the impact that they share at the Enactus Canada National Exposition, which will ultimately determine who represents our country at the 2015 Enactus World Cup in Johannesburg, South Africa.
The past two years Enactus has developed new metrics and frameworks to try and capture the impact that we are having here in Canada and around the world. Last year, we rolled out this new framework and data points and collected more robust impact data than ever before. It has allowed us to better tell our story to those who support us while also allowing us to hold each other accountable to what we all claim as impact. It is also helping to frame the rollout of future programs and is helping to shape our organization’s strategy moving forward.
